Dick Dean Brown

Feb. 12, 1911 - Oct 10, 2000

Dick D. Brown, 89, of Galien, Mich., died on Tuesday, Oct. 10, in South Bend, Ind. Dick was born on Feb. 12, 1911, in Dowagiac, Mich.

On Nov. 18, 1933, in South Bend, he married Mary Ruth Baker, who died in 1991.

He was a retired manager of Bendix. He belonged to Trinity Episcopal Church, Niles, enjoyed hunting, fishing, sports (ND), and the Civil War.

He is survived by two daughters, Carol Brown-Schlutt of Bridgman, Mich., and Sally (James) Hoit of Guide Rock, Neb. and by six grandchildren and three great-grandchildren.

Services will be at 11 a.m. on Friday, Oct. 13, in the Swem Funeral Home, Buchanan, with burial at St. Joseph Memorial Park, South Bend. Friends may call from 2 to 4 and 6 to 9 p.m. on Thursday, Oct. 12. in the funeral home. Memorial contributions may be made to the American Kidney Association
